Learner Driver: Terms & Conditions

To have driving lessons you must:

  • Be aged 17 or older (16 or over if disabled)
  • Hold a driving license that is valid for the UK (provisional, full or an appropriate foreign licence)
  • legally entitled to drive in the UK.

It is your responsibility to provide your instructor with proof that you have a valid licence to drive before the commencement of your first driving lesson. If you fail to provide this proof, your instructor is entitled to refuse to conduct the driving lesson but may still charge you for such a lesson.
